Dress Code

Flempton Golf Club is a private members club that adheres to the traditional ethos of the game yet wishes to provide a relaxed and enjoyable experience for members and visitors alike.

It is a requirement when at Flempton that all golfers comply with our dress code.

On the Course

(Includes the practice areas and putting green)

Smart casual dress is acceptable, including tailored shorts, subject to the following:

• No denim jeans, collarless shirts or ‘cargo’ style trousers/shorts
• Gentlemen are asked to wear shirts that are tucked in
• Short socks with shorts are permitted with a preference for them to be white.
• Tracksuits and rugby/football tops are not permitted
• Recognised golf shoes should be worn

In the Clubhouse

(Includes the car park and areas surrounding the Clubhouse)

Smart casual attire, (including smart denim jeans), unless a specific dress code is required for an event/match
It is not acceptable to wear any form of headgear within the bar, dining or internal seating areas unless dispensation is granted by the Club Manager.

Within the Clubhouse it is acceptable to wear clean spike-less golf shoes in order to access the bar and the PSI terminal
Please avoid bringing wet/dirty clothing and golf equipment into the Clubhouse
